Question:
Canola oil is less dense than water, so it floats on water, butits index of refraction is 1.47, higher than that ofwater. When you are adding oil and water to a bottle to make saladdressing, you notice a silvery reflection of light from theboundary between the oil and water.
What is the critical angle for light going from the oil into thewater?
